What to Buy for Chocolate Peanut Butter Marshmallow Clouds

When it comes to baking these delightful cookies, choosing the right ingredients is essential. Each component plays a significant role in delivering those mouthwatering flavors and textures. The combination of flour, cocoa, and peanut butter creates a rich base, while the marshmallows and chocolate provide that signature sweetness we all love.
- All-purpose flour: The backbone of any cookie, providing structure and a chewy texture.
- Unsweetened baking cocoa: Adds a deep chocolate flavor to the cookies without excessive sweetness.
- Baking soda: Helps the cookies rise and become fluffy while baking.
- Salt: Enhances the flavors and balances the sweetness of the cookies.
- Light brown sugar: Contributes moisture and a slight caramel flavor, making the cookies rich.
- Granulated sugar: Provides sweetness and a crisp texture to the cookies’ edges.
- Unsalted butter: Gives the cookies a rich, creamy flavor; be sure to melt it for the best results.
- Smooth peanut butter: The star ingredient that provides creaminess and a nutty taste.
- Vanilla extract: A classic flavor enhancer that rounds out the taste of the cookies.
- Egg: Binds the ingredients together and adds richness.
- Coffee: Deepens the chocolate flavor; it’s optional but highly recommended.
- Chopped pecans: Adds a delightful crunch and nuttiness to the cookies.
- Large marshmallows: The gooey topping that makes these cookies special.
- Semi-sweet chocolate chips: Used for melting and drizzling over the cookies for extra decadence.
- Heavy whipping cream: Helps create a smooth frosting when mixed with chocolate.
- Butter: Added to the frosting for creaminess.
- Powdered sugar: Sweetens the frosting and helps achieve the desired consistency.
The Process for Making Chocolate Peanut Butter Marshmallow Clouds

Making Chocolate Peanut Butter Marshmallow Clouds is a joyous experience that brings the sweet aroma of baking into your kitchen. Follow these detailed steps to ensure your cookies turn out perfectly every time!
- Preheat your oven to 375 degrees. This is a crucial step because starting with a hot oven ensures that your cookies bake evenly and rise beautifully.
- Line a cookie sheet with parchment paper or lightly grease it. This step prevents the cookies from sticking and helps them bake evenly.
- In a large bowl, whisk together flour, cocoa, baking soda, and salt. This mixture forms the dry ingredients that will give structure to your cookies. Set it aside.
- In another bowl, cream together light brown sugar, granulated sugar, butter, and peanut butter until the mixture is light and fluffy. This process incorporates air into the dough, helping the cookies rise.
- Add in the egg, vanilla extract, and coffee, and beat until well combined. The wet ingredients will enhance the richness of your cookie dough.
- Gradually stir in the dry ingredients until everything is just combined. Be careful not to overmix; this can make the cookies tough.
- Fold in the chopped pecans. This adds a lovely crunch to your cookies. Ensure they’re evenly distributed throughout the dough.
- Scoop out rounded tablespoons of cookie dough onto the prepared cookie sheet. Your dough will be thick, which is perfect for achieving a chewy texture.
- Flatten each cookie slightly with your hands. This will help them spread evenly while baking.
- Bake in the preheated oven for about 6 minutes, then remove them. The cookies will look slightly underbaked, which is what you want!
- Carefully press half a marshmallow, cut side down, into the top of each cookie. This adds a sweet, gooey surprise to the center.
- Return the cookies to the oven and bake for an additional 1 to 2 minutes. You want the marshmallows to soften but not melt completely.
- Remove from the oven and let them cool on the cookie s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a cooling rack. This allows the cookies to set up a bit.
- In a medium bowl, melt chocolate chips in the microwave. Heat on high for 30 seconds, stir, and repeat until smooth. This will be your delicious topping.
- Add heavy whipping cream, butter, and another splash of vanilla extract to the melted chocolate. Stir until combined.
- Gradually stir in powdered sugar until you reach your desired frosting consistency. This frosting will be rich and creamy, perfect for drizzling over the cookies.
- Spoon the frosting over the top of each cooled cookie. Let it stand until the frosting has set. This final step makes your cookies look irresistible!
Things Worth Knowing
- Use room temperature ingredients: This helps to ensure that everything mixes together smoothly.
- Don’t overbake: Cookies should be slightly soft in the center when you remove them from the oven.
- Let cookies cool completely: This helps them firm up and makes decorating easier.
- Store in an airtight container: To keep cookies fresh, store them in a cool, dry place.
Making Adjustments

Whether you’re looking to customize your cookies or adapt them to dietary needs, there are plenty of adjustments you can make when preparing Chocolate Peanut Butter Marshmallow Clouds. Here are some great tips to consider:
- Storage: To store leftovers, keep your cookies in an airtight container at room temperature. They can stay fresh for up to a week.
- Freezing: You can freeze the cookie dough before baking. Just scoop them onto a baking sheet, freeze until solid, then transfer to a zip-top bag. When ready to bake, just add a minute or two to the baking time.
- Pairing: These cookies pair beautifully with a glass of milk or a cup of coffee, enhancing the flavors of the peanut butter and chocolate.
- Variations: Substitute peanut butter with other nut butters or sunflower seed butter for a nut-free version.
- Frosting options: Feel free to experiment with different toppings, like caramel drizzle or crushed nuts.
